Air flow and convective heat loss from small mammals in laboratory metabolism chambers
Authors:Craig A. Stewart   James Owens  Polley A. McClure
Affiliation:

Department of Biology, Jordan Hall, Indiana University, Bloomington, IN 47405, U.S.A.

Abstract:

1. 1.Thermal conductance was determined from cooling curves of Mus domesticus carcasses at air flow rates ranging from still air to 0.91·min−1 STP. Thermal conductance was constant over this range of air flows. This indicates that free convection predominates over forced convection at these air flow rates.

2. 2.While non single set of conditions will be appropriate for all experiments, free convection conditions are appropriate for determination of minimal thermal conductance.
